E-Commerce in China MasterclassRDA Central West, in collaboration with NSW Department of Primary Industries International Engagement Unit, presents the E-commerce in China Masterclass for businesses in Central West NSW. 

Specially designed for regional agribusinesses and businesses, this one-day masterclass will explore the opportunities, risks and various pathways to engage successfully in e-commerce in China.

Wed 28 March 2018, 9.30am – 4.30pm
The Canobolas Hotel, Summer Street, Orange NSW
Free

Industry guest speakers discussing subjects including;

  • Branding and marketing your product for the Chinese consumer
  • Understanding Chinese market influencers – Diagous and KOLs
  • Chinese social media – Wechat and Weibo – getting your head around the importance of social media to the Chinese consumer
  • Austrade and other support agencies
  • e-commerce platforms and pathways
  • Risk and IP issues

Plus e-commerce experience case studies and Q&A sessions with three local NSW agribusinesses;

  • MSM Milling Auzure Canola Oil – Genya Miller
  • Mortimer’s Wines – Peter Mortimer
  • Superbee Honey – Ross Christiansen
